General Plant Information (Edit)
Plant Habit: Herb/Forb
Life cycle: Perennial
Sun Requirements: Partial or Dappled Shade
Minimum cold hardiness: Zone 3 -40 °C (-40 °F) to -37.2 °C (-35)
Maximum recommended zone: Zone 8b
Plant Height: 10-18 in. tall (medium)
Plant Spread: 24-36 in. (60-90 cm)
Leaves: Unusual foliage color
Other: Growth is upright, Leaves are Ovate, Cupped and pure white with a slightly Blue-green margin.
Flower Color: Other: Pale lavender, Tubular shape.
Flower Time: Summer
Underground structures: Rhizome
Uses: Groundcover
Propagation: Seeds: Will not come true from seed
Propagation: Other methods: Division
